A facile way to synthesize Er2O3@ZnO core-shell nanorods for photoelectrochemical water splitting
چکیده انگلیسی


• Er2O3@ZnO core-shell nanorods were successfully fabricated by an electrochemical process.
• The as-prepared composites exhibited improved photocurrent under the light irradiation.
• The results indicate that the composites hold great promise for PEC water splitting.

In this study, we demonstrated large-scale Er2O3@ZnO core-shell nanorods with great photoelectrochemical water splitting ability, which were successfully fabricated by a simple and facile electrodeposition. These Er2O3@ZnO core-shell nanorods exhibited improved photocurrent under the light irradiation, which can be attributed to the enhanced donor density by the covered Er2O3.
